Format registers

Each format register is made up of three decimal fields:
● Decimal offset
● Secondary index
● Primary index
The primary and secondary indexes correspond to those that are used by the parameter.
The decimal offset indicates how the remote system must interpret the integer value that
is stored in the parameter access register. The following table shows how different
parameter values can be shown based on a register value (integer) of 1234.
Examples of using the format word for both the index values and the decimal offset value
are shown below:
To write these values you can use a decimal offset as follows: format word = (primary
index x 1 000) + (secondary index x 10) + (decimal).
